Red clay can be seen almost any- where that a hole is dug, a field is plowed, or a dirt bank is exposed by erosion or human activity. After a heavy rain, even the rivers and streams take on the red color of the soil. Several circumstances contribute to the formation of red clay soils. Before you even start with your clay, you should put your idea and design down on paper. You do not have to be a great sketch artist, as you are simply provided a framework from which to work. A good idea is to make sketches that are from various angles, and maybe even put down an image that is to scale. Jennie Deckow is a renowned Professional in making Pottery and Ceramics.

It is possible to buy porcelain that has been grogged with fine molochite. This makes it easier to work with, but it is still not the easiest pottery clay for beginners. Although beautiful, porcelain, is often referred to as being quite high maintenance. Porcelain is often described as ‘fussy’ or ‘finickity’ clay. Porcelain is not very forgiving if you are throwing it and there is a small bump in the clay.
